Des del Escritorio del Pastor Segundo Domingo de Cuaresma

La Primavera está a la vuelta de la esquina y todo comienza a nacer, a ponerse verde y a crecer nuevamente.

Es realmente sorprendente ver como las plantas son renovadas al calor de la Primavera.

Nosotros como gente de Dios, también experimentamos una renovación en nuestra fe. Esta renovación puede pasar de muchas y diferentes maneras. La Renovación puede venir de los Sacramentos, de la oración, por medio de la Meditación en las Escrituras, y de muchas otras formas…..Durante la Cuaresma, estamos viendo más gente en la celebración Eucarística de las Misas diarias. La Cuaresma nos ha dado la oportunidad de hacer cambios en nuestra vida para que podamos escuchar al Señor más atentamente.

San Pablo nos dice: Renovarse por el Espíritu desde dentro…. (Efesios 4:22-25).

Queridos amigos, el mensaje de la Transfiguración es que hay una conexión entre el Sufrimiento, la Muerte, la Resurrección y la Gloria. Cuando las cosas son diferentes es bueno recordar que no hay atajos hacia la gloria. La verdadera felicidad y tranquilidad de conciencia vienen solamente después del Calvario, porque la Cruz y el sufrimiento son inescapables.

La Transfiguración es acerca de dejar que la Gloria de Dios brillé por medio de nosotros para que los demás puedan tener un pequeño vistazo de esa gloria.

Jesús llénanos con la luz de tu amor y de tu fe. Haznos brillar en la oscuridad y toca las vidas de los demás con la luz de tu Bondad.

From the Pastor’s Desk Second Sunday of Lent

Spring is just around the corner and everything is beginning to sprout, turn green and grow again.

It’s really amazing how plants are renewed in the warmth of Spring.

We as people of God also experience renewal in our faith. This renewal can take place in many different ways. Renewal can come from Sacraments, from prayer, through Meditation on the Scriptures, and many other forms…..During Lent, we are seeing more people at the weekday celebration of the Eucharist. Lent has given us the opportunity to make changes in our life so that we can listen to the Lord more closely.

St. Paul tells us: Make a fresh start and change your heart…. (Ephesians 4:22-25).

My dear friends, the message of the Transfiguration is that there is a connection between suffering and death and the Resurrection and Glory. When things are different it is good to remember that there is no short cut to Glory. Real happiness and peace of mind only come after Calvary because the Cross and suffering are inescapable.

The Transfiguration is about letting the glory of God shine through us so that others can catch a glimpse of that glory.

Jesus fills us with the light of your love and faith. Make us shine in the darkness and touch the lives of others with the light of your Goodness.
